Removing a/c compressor
Alright guys it looks as if I'll have a ton more room and lose a few lbs if I take out my a/c compresor. My ? to the gurus here is what do I need in place of the compressor? An idler of just a belt from a non a/c car? I tried searching ac removal and got all kinds of non-related threads. Thanks ahead of time.

1: Shorter belt. Any auto parts store can sell you this, just ask for a belt for a Miata with P/S but without A/C. They're common.
2: A slightly shorter bolt to replace the one that's currently going front-to-back through the front of the compressor mounting bracket (the piece made from cast lead). This bolt also happens to hold the oil pump on, and a few of us (myself included) learned by experience what happens when you leave it off. Can't remember the length, size, or pitch. Just measure the old one and buy a new one that's shorter by the thickness of the bracket.
